Commission to hold special meeting today

Anna Maria City Commission Chair John Quam has scheduled a special commission meeting at 7 p.m. today, June 10, to reconsider the commission’s May 27 denial of a site plan for 308 Pine Ave.

The commission had rejected the site plan at the May 27 public hearing by a 3-2 vote following more than two hours of testimony. The plan was presented by developer Pine Avenue Restoration LLC.

Quam sided with Commissioners Dale Woodland and Harry Stoltzfus to deny the plan, while Commissioners Chuck Webb and Jo Ann Mattick voted to adopt the PAR site plan.

Also on the special meeting agenda are discussion of the Walker parcel on Park Street and interpretation of the site-plan expiration for 303 Pine Ave. The commission also will hold the first reading of a moratorium on new construction in the conservation land-use category of the comprehensive plan.

Quam scheduled the special meeting after city attorney Jim Dye sent him a letter last week saying that, according to Robert’s Rules of Order, the city can reconsider a vote. However, the motion to reconsider must come from a commissioner who voted with the majority to deny the plan.

Dye said the commission should not reconsider the vote if action has been taken by an outside party on the basis of the first vote, but, in his opinion, no action has yet been taken by an outside party.

Commissioners must first approve a motion to reconsider before re-opening discussion on the PAR site plan.
